Care Overview

  • Difficulty: Intermediate–Advanced
  • Temperature: 24–28°C
  • Humidity: Moderate to high
  • Diet: Fine organic matter, leaf litter, and small food particles
  • Minimum substrate depth: 2 inches
  • Size: 8–10mm

A very small, active species suited to a more bioactive-style setup with a lot of leaf litter.

These charismatic small roaches are full of character, for their small size.

Although they are smaller than most cockroaches their active nature more than makes up for it.

A mature colony of Kenyan Dwarf Cockroaches is a joy to keep, full of activity.

They also make great feeders for dart frogs and smaller species of predatory invertebrates or nymphs.

They will feed on leaf litter, fresh fruit and veg and dry pellet foods.
